diff options
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 13 |
1 files changed, 3 insertions, 10 deletions
diff --git a/configure.ac b/configure.ac index d6842670a2..8f8b9338f0 100644 --- a/configure.ac +++ b/configure.ac @@ -891,14 +891,15 @@ AC_SUBST(NM_CONFIG_DEFAULT_MAIN_DHCP, $config_dhcp_default) AC_ARG_WITH(resolvconf, AS_HELP_STRING([--with-resolvconf=yes|no|path], [Enable resolvconf support])) AC_ARG_WITH(netconfig, AS_HELP_STRING([--with-netconfig=yes|no], [Enable SUSE netconfig support])) -AC_ARG_WITH(config-dns-rc-manager-default, AS_HELP_STRING([--with-config-dns-rc-manager-default=symlink|file|netconfig|resolvconf], [Configure default value for main.rc-manager setting]), [config_dns_rc_manager_default=$withval]) +AC_ARG_WITH(config-dns-rc-manager-default, AS_HELP_STRING([--with-config-dns-rc-manager-default=auto|symlink|file|netconfig|resolvconf], [Configure default value for main.rc-manager setting]), [config_dns_rc_manager_default=$withval]) if test "$config_dns_rc_manager_default" != "" -a \ + "$config_dns_rc_manager_default" != auto -a \ "$config_dns_rc_manager_default" != file -a \ "$config_dns_rc_manager_default" != symlink -a \ "$config_dns_rc_manager_default" != netconfig -a \ "$config_dns_rc_manager_default" != resolvconf; then AC_MSG_WARN([Unknown --with-config-dns-rc-manager-default=$config_dns_rc_manager_default setting.]) - config_dns_rc_manager_default= + config_dns_rc_manager_default=auto fi # Use netconfig by default on SUSE AS_IF([test -z "$with_netconfig" -a -f /etc/SuSE-release], with_netconfig=yes) @@ -912,9 +913,6 @@ if test "$with_resolvconf" = "yes"; then AC_MSG_ERROR(cannot find resolvconf in path. Set the path explicitly via --with-resolvconf=PATH.) fi fi -if test "$with_resolvconf" != "no"; then - AS_IF([test -z "$config_dns_rc_manager_default"], config_dns_rc_manager_default=resolvconf) -fi if test "$with_netconfig" = "yes"; then AC_PATH_PROGS(with_netconfig, netconfig, yes, /sbin:/usr/sbin:/usr/local/sbin) @@ -922,11 +920,6 @@ if test "$with_netconfig" = "yes"; then AC_MSG_ERROR(cannot find netconfig in path. Set the path explicitly via --with-netconfig=PATH.) fi fi -if test "$with_netconfig" != "no"; then - AS_IF([test -z "$config_dns_rc_manager_default"], config_dns_rc_manager_default=netconfig) -fi - -AS_IF([test -z "$config_dns_rc_manager_default"], config_dns_rc_manager_default=symlink) if test "$with_resolvconf" != "no"; then AC_DEFINE_UNQUOTED(RESOLVCONF_PATH, "$with_resolvconf", [Path to resolvconf]) |